Hillslope Materials and Processes. Second Edition. M. J. Selby. with a contribution by A. P. W. Hodder. Description. This book is intended for students who approach the study of hillslopes, and the rocks and soils on which they develop, from such traditional disciplines as geomorphology, geology, engineering, and soil science. The following are discussed: (a) weathering processes, (b) landforms resulting from weathering, (c) strength and behaviour of rock and soil, (d) water on hillslopes, (e) mass wasting of soils, (f) processes on rock hillslopes, (g) tors and bornhandts, (k) slope profiles and models of slope. Hillslope Evolution By Diffusive Processes Although some of the assumptions behind the idea of hill- slope evolution by diffusive transport processes were implicitly stated by Gilbert [, ] and Davis [], it was only after the work of Culling [] that the underlying mathematical relationships were fully described.
